Οι τακτικοί χρήστες του Διαδικτύου είναι εξοικειωμένοι με τους όρους ανοιχτού κώδικα και ελεύθερο λογισμικό και εκείνοι που δεν πληρώνουν μεγάλο ενδιαφέρον για τα ονόματα μπορεί να συγχέονται μεταξύ των δύο. Μια τρίτη ποικιλία λογισμικού είναι το ιδιόκτητο λογισμικό, για το οποίο ίσως δεν έχετε ακούσει. Χωρίς ανησυχίες! Αφού διαβάσετε αυτό το άρθρο, μπορείτε να γνωρίζετε απρόσκοπτα τη διαφορά μεταξύ των διαφόρων κατηγοριών.
Εδώ σε αυτό το άρθρο, σας ενημερώνουμε για τα πλεονεκτήματα του λογισμικού ανοιχτού κώδικα μέσω του ιδιόκτητου λογισμικού και επίσης ποια είναι τα οφέλη του λογισμικού Free & Open Source;
Ιδιωτικό λογισμικό! Τώρα τι είναι αυτό
Ένα ιδιόκτητο λογισμικό είναι ένα λογισμικό, όπου οι χρήστες μπορούν να χρησιμοποιήσουν το λογισμικό, είτε δωρεάν είτε πληρώνοντας ένα ποσό, είτε μία φορά, είτε πληρώνοντας κάποια χρήματα κάθε μήνα, έτος κλπ. Ο πηγαίος κώδικας του λογισμικού διατηρείται μυστικό ένας οργανισμός ή ο προγραμματιστής και δεν μοιράζεται, σε αντίθεση με τις ανοιχτές πηγές. Το ιδιόκτητο λογισμικό είναι ακριβώς απέναντι από το λογισμικό ανοιχτού κώδικα, του οποίου ο πηγαίος κώδικας είναι διαθέσιμος στο κοινό κοινό. Η ανάγνωση όλων αυτών, ίσως να πιστεύετε ότι το ελεύθερο λογισμικό δεν εμπλέκεται στο ιδιόκτητο λογισμικό. Αλλά δεν είναι έτσι.
Λογισμικό ιδιοκτησίας και ανοιχτού κώδικα
Το λογισμικό που είναι δωρεάν αλλά όχι ανοιχτό κώδικα ονομάζεται ιδιόκτητο λογισμικό. Εάν ο πηγαίος κώδικας ενός ελεύθερου λογισμικού δεν είναι διαθέσιμος στο κοινό κοινό για περαιτέρω έρευνα και ανάπτυξη, εμπίπτει στον τομέα του ιδιόκτητου λογισμικού.Apple iTunesείναι ένα ελεύθερο λογισμικό, αλλά ο πηγαίος κώδικας του διατηρείται μυστικός, επομένως ανήκει στην οικογένεια λογισμικού ιδιοκτησίας. Από την άλλη πλευρά, πολύ δημοφιλέςΑνοικτό γραφείοείναι δωρεάν και ο πηγαίος κώδικας είναι επίσης διαθέσιμος και επομένως είναι ένα λογισμικό ανοιχτού κώδικα. Δείτε την παρακάτω εικόνα για να γνωρίζετε τις κατηγορίες λογισμικού, ακόμα καλύτερα.
Ελεύθερο λογισμικό και κάποια επεξεργασία
Ελεύθερο λογισμικό, ο όρος είναι κάπως αυτονόητος. Ναι, μπορείτε να χρησιμοποιήσετε δωρεάν το πλήρες λογισμικό ή τουλάχιστον να αποκτήσετε δωρεάν τις βασικές λειτουργίες του λογισμικού. Αν και σε πολλές περιπτώσεις, μπορείτε να χρησιμοποιήσετε ένα συγκεκριμένο λογισμικό δωρεάν για προσωπικές χρήσεις, αλλά πρέπει να πληρώσετε κάποια επιπλέον για να αποκτήσετε εμπορική άδεια, αν θέλετε να το χρησιμοποιήσετε για την επιχείρησή σας.
Μια ματιά στο λογισμικό ανοιχτού κώδικα
Ενώ από την άλλη πλευρά το λογισμικό ανοιχτού κώδικα είναι δωρεάν, αλλά σε ορισμένες περιπτώσεις, ίσως χρειαστεί να πληρώσετε κάποιες πένες σε ορισμένους προμηθευτές τρίτων, αν θέλετε να ενσωματώσετε ένα λογισμικό ανοιχτού κώδικα με υπάρχον τομέα ή θέλετε να κάνετε επιπλέον εργασίες με αυτό. Ορισμένα λογισμικά ανοιχτού κώδικα μπορούν επίσης να τροποποιηθούν από τους προγραμματιστές και το ίδιο μπορεί επίσης να είναι διαθέσιμο σε σας με μια τιμή.
Για να σας δείξουμε ένα παράδειγμα,Λίνουξείναι λογισμικό ανοιχτού κώδικα, αλλάΚόκκινο καπέλοείναι έναΛίνουξDistro, το οποίο έρχεται επίσης με μια τιμή.
Μετά την κατασκευή του δικού σας νέου υπολογιστή, μπορεί να είναι ένα δύσκολο έργο να φιλοξενήσετε κάποιο νέο λογισμικό μέσα στον προϋπολογισμό σας. Σε αυτές τις περιπτώσεις, μπορείτε να αρχίσετε να χρησιμοποιείτε κάποιο λογισμικό δωρεάν και ανοιχτού κώδικα για μερικές ημέρες, προτού μεταβείτε σε μια πληρωμένη έκδοση της ίδιας κατηγορίας. Η χρήση του ελεύθερου λογισμικού μπορεί επίσης να εκπληρώσει τις απαιτήσεις σας, επειδή με εμπιστεύεστε, κάποιο λογισμικό δωρεάν και ανοιχτού κώδικα είναι όλος ο τρόπος με τους ομολόγους των υψηλότερων τιμών.
Διαφορές μεταξύ λογισμικού ελεύθερου και ανοιχτού κώδικα
Η βασική διαφορά μεταξύ του λογισμικού ελεύθερου και ανοιχτού κώδικα είναι ότι, σε περίπτωση ελεύθερων, το λογισμικό μπορεί να είναι ελεύθερο να χρησιμοποιήσει και να διανείμει, αλλά ο πηγαίος κώδικας δεν είναι διαθέσιμος στο ευρύ κοινό, το οποίο μπορεί να βοηθήσει τους προγραμματιστές να προσθέσουν μερικά προσοδοφόρα χαρακτηριστικά με μια τιμή. Σε περίπτωση λογισμικού ανοιχτού κώδικα, ο πηγαίος κώδικας είναι διαθέσιμος στο ευρύ κοινό δωρεάν, δίνοντάς τους πεδία για περαιτέρω βελτιώσεις. Το λογισμικό ανοιχτού κώδικα έρχεται μεΔημόσια άδεια GNUήGPL, τα οποία δίνουν το δικαίωμα σε άλλους, να επεξεργαστούν ή να τροποποιήσουν τον πηγαίο κώδικα για περαιτέρω εξελίξεις.
Χωρίς περαιτέρω καθυστέρηση, ας εξερευνήσουμε τα πλεονεκτήματα του ελεύθερου λογισμικού.
- Εκτός από το να είναι δωρεάν, το ελεύθερο λογισμικό είναι εύκολο να πάρει. Τα εμπλεκόμενα βήματα, αναζητώντας ένα λογισμικό, επιλέγοντας μια πηγή και κατεβάστε το από την προτιμώμενη πηγή σας. Εγκαταστήστε το.
- Το ελεύθερο λογισμικό μπορεί εύκολα να διανεμηθεί, το οποίο είναι επίσης σαν να κάνετε μια κοινωνική υπηρεσία. Απλά γελάω. Αλλά μπορείτε εύκολα να βοηθήσετε τους φίλους σας ή την οικογένειά σας που έχουν ανάγκη εάν χρειάζονται κάποιο λογισμικό για ένα σκοπό.
- Οι διορθώσεις σφαλμάτων και η λύση σε άλλα προβλήματα ή ενημερώσεις λογισμικού, με απλά λόγια, είναι απλώς θέμα λίγων ημερών, σε περίπτωση ελεύθερου λογισμικού, αν και εξαρτάται από τους ανταγωνιστές. Ένας προγραμματιστής ενός ελεύθερου λογισμικού που ευδοκιμεί ανάμεσα σε έναν διαγωνισμό cut-throat θα προσπαθήσει να διατηρήσει τους πελάτες με την αποστολή ταχύτερων ενημερώσεων, έτσι ώστε οι χρήστες να μην σκέφτονται μια δεύτερη λεωφόρο.
- Το πιο ελεύθερο λογισμικό μπορεί να ληφθεί από τους χρήστες με τη μορφή φορητής έκδοσης, η οποία μπορεί να διατηρήσει την πίεση σε ένα σύστημα, καθώς δεν απαιτούν εγκατάσταση. Το λογισμικό μπορεί να είναι σε μια μονάδα flash USB, κεντρικό διακομιστή ή στο σύννεφο.
PortableApps.comΕίναι μία από τις καλύτερες φορητές πλατφόρμες εφαρμογών, προσωπικά προτιμώ.
Δεν αναφέρουμε τα μειονεκτήματα δεν θα είναι δίκαιη. Ας ρίξουμε μια ματιά στα μειονεκτήματα.
- Το ελεύθερο λογισμικό μπορεί μερικές φορές να έρθει με διαφημίσεις, οι οποίες μπορεί να είναι αρκετά ενοχλητικές κατά καιρούς. Δεν υπάρχει αμφιβολία ότι οι προγραμματιστές χρειάζονται υποστήριξη, αλλά αυτό δεν πρέπει να είναι με κόστος ικανοποίησης του χρήστη. Ωστόσο, οι μικρές διαφημίσεις, στην κορυφή, ή κάτω από την εφαρμογή, είναι αποδεκτές. Οι όροι και οι προϋποθέσεις θα αποκαλυφθούν, εάν το λογισμικό μπορεί να σας δείξει διαφημίσεις.
- Το ελεύθερο λογισμικό, το οποίο απαιτεί την εγκατάσταση, μπορεί να προέλθει από πολλαπλές πηγές και μπορεί να προσθέσει κακόβουλο λογισμικό στο πακέτο του εγκαταστάτη, όμως, δεν θα κάνω τους προγραμματιστές υπεύθυνους γι 'αυτό. Ανάγνωση της περιγραφής λήψης σωστά και διατηρώντας τα μάτια ανοιχτά κατά τη στιγμή της εγκατάστασης, μπορεί να σας βοηθήσει να κρατήσετε μακριά την εγκατάσταση κακόβουλου λογισμικού και bloatware.
ΝίνιοςΕίναι η προσωπική μου αγαπημένη πλατφόρμα για να κατεβάσετε το λογισμικό Windows, το οποίο μπορεί να σας βοηθήσει να εγκαταστήσετε πολλές εφαρμογές ταυτόχρονα και είναι διαθέσιμο χωρίς κανένα κακόβουλο λογισμικό.
- Ορισμένα ελεύθερα λογισμικά μπορούν επίσης να έρθουν με ωφέλιμα φορτία, τα οποία μπορούν να παρακολουθήσουν τη δραστηριότητα του χρήστη στο λογισμικό. Αργότερα, τα δεδομένα χρησιμοποιούνται για λειτουργίες εξόρυξης δεδομένων, κάτι που δεν αποτελεί ζήτημα ιδιωτικής ζωής για την πλειοψηφία, αλλά πολλοί χρήστες ενδέχεται να το μισούν προσωπικά. Ανάγνωση τουΌροι και προϋποθέσειςήΙδιωτική πολιτικήμπορεί να αποκαλύψει σωστά εάν η εφαρμογή θα συλλέξει δεδομένα χρήστη ή όχι.
Ας αλλάξουμε τώρα την προσοχή μας στο λογισμικό ανοιχτού κώδικα, το οποίο σε ορισμένες περιπτώσεις είναι καλύτερη ή χειρότερη, σε σύγκριση με το Free. Το λογισμικό ανοιχτού κώδικα είναι επίσης καλύτερο από το ιδιόκτητο λογισμικό για διάφορους λόγους.
Ας ρίξουμε μια ματιά στα πλεονεκτήματα/πλεονεκτήματα της ανοιχτού κώδικα
- Το λογισμικό ανοιχτού κώδικα είναι ελεύθερα διαθέσιμο και διαθέτει ακόμη περισσότερες λειτουργίες, καθώς οι ομάδες προγραμματισμού μπορούν να προσθέσουν νέα χαρακτηριστικά από καιρό σε καιρό δωρεάν, γεγονός που μπορεί να τα κάνει πιο ισχυρά από τα ιδιόκτητα, αρκετά συχνά.
- Το λογισμικό ανοιχτού κώδικα είναι αρκετά αποτελεσματικό κατά την αποστολή ενημερώσεων και διορθώσεων σφαλμάτων, καθώς ένα μόνο πρόβλημα σε ένα λογισμικό θα είναι ορατό σε εκατομμύρια ομάδες προγραμματισμού, ικανές να το διορθώσουν ταυτόχρονα. Μερικοί προγραμματιστές σίγουρα θα βουτήξουν για να διορθώσουν το ζήτημα, αποστέλλοντας τη λύση το νωρίτερο. Ενώ το αγορασμένο ιδιόκτητο λογισμικό θα αποστείλει ενημερώσεις, αλλά στις περισσότερες περιπτώσεις χρειάζονται ημέρες ή εβδομάδες.
- Καθώς ο πηγαίος κώδικας είναι ελεύθερα διαθέσιμος, μπορείτε να τον τροποποιήσετε σύμφωνα με τις απαιτήσεις σας, υπό την προϋπόθεση ότι έχετε γνώσεις κωδικοποίησης και να κάνετε το λογισμικό το δικό σας φλιτζάνι τσάι. Έχετε επίσης την άδεια να διανείμετε το ίδιο, στις περισσότερες περιπτώσεις, αλλά να διαβάσετε καλύτερα τη συμφωνία άδειας χρήσης, να κρατήσετε μακριά τυχόν παρενοχλήσεις. Η κοινή χρήση ή η διανομή του ιδιόκτητου λογισμικού είναι ανεπίσημη στις περισσότερες περιπτώσεις.
- Η λήψη πακέτων λογισμικού ανοιχτού κώδικα από το Διαδίκτυο είναι πολύ εύκολη και δεν μπορείτε να πάρετε μόνο το πακέτο, αλλά και τον πηγαίο κώδικα του ίδιου από τον επίσημο ιστότοπο του λογισμικού ή του πακέτου.
Ας ρίξουμε μια ματιά στα μειονεκτήματα. Υπόσχομαι ότι δεν θα είναι μακρύ.
- Η ραχοκοκαλιά των πλατφορμών ανοιχτού κώδικα είναι μια ομάδα εθελοντικών ομάδων προγραμματισμού, οι οποίες έχουν την ικανότητα να παρέχουν γρήγορες διορθώσεις και ενημερώσεις για την πλατφόρμα. Εάν για οποιονδήποτε λόγο οι ομάδες σταματούν να δείχνουν το ενδιαφέρον τους για το έργο, το έργο θα είναι νεκρό.
- Οι ενημερώσεις για το λογισμικό ανοιχτού κώδικα είναι πολύ γρήγορες. Αν και είναι ένα πλεονέκτημα, αλλά ένα νόμισμα έχει επίσης την ουρά του. Οι συχνές ενημερώσεις για ένα λογισμικό μπορεί να το κάνουν ασταθές για ένα συγκεκριμένο σύστημα, η αντιμετώπιση του οποίου μπορεί να πάρει ακόμη περισσότερο χρόνο.
Τώρα τα πράγματα είναι σαφήΔωρεάν λογισμικό και ανοιχτού κώδικα.Γιατί να μην ρίξετε μια ματιά σε μερικές ελεύθερες ή ανοιχτές εναλλακτικές λύσεις για κάποιο δημοφιλές πληρωμένο λογισμικό και πακέτα.
[one_third]
Παράδειγμα ανοιχτού κώδικα
Ubuntu,Εκατοστό,Ωυσία,Νομισματοκοπείο Linux
[/one_third]
[one_third]
Παράδειγμα λογισμικού ιδιόκτητου ή πληρωμένου λογισμικού
Microsoft Office (Λογισμικό Suite Office)
Adobe Photoshop (λογισμικό επεξεργασίας φωτογραφιών)
Windows (OS)
Winzip / WinRar (λογισμικό συμπίεσης)
Nero StatsMart /Express (CD /DVD Burning)
[/one_third]
Δείτε επίσης: